Year 1
Year 1 English builds upon the foundational skills developed in Foundation. Students continue to refine their reading and writing abilities, focusing on phonics, decoding, and fluency. They begin to read simple texts independently and develop their vocabulary and comprehension skills.
In writing, year 1 students learn to construct simple sentences, use capital letters and full stops, and express ideas through words and illustrations. This year's curriculum is important as it establishes fundamental reading and writing skills, enabling students to become more confident readers and writers.

Year 3
Year 3 English curriculum resources focus on developing students' reading, writing, speaking and listening skills across various text types and genres.
Explore resources to help students learn to analyse and evaluate texts, make predictions and infer meaning in their reading.
Develop your students' understanding of narrative and descriptive writing, as well as persuasive and informative writing.
Our spelling and grammar resources will help students learn about plurals, verb tenses and punctuation marks and expand their vocabulary.
Our curriculum-aligned options for year 3 emphasise critical thinking and communication skills, encouraging students to become more independent and thoughtful readers and writers.

Year 5
The Australian English curriculum in year 5 emphasises higher-level comprehension and composition skills, and Teach Starter's year 5 reading resources allow students to engage with more complex texts, including novels, plays and multimodal texts.
Students can analyse themes, viewpoints and literary techniques in their reading.
Our year 5 writing resources allow students to plan, draft, revise and edit their work, incorporating various text structures and literary devices. The resources also help students expand their vocabulary, grammar and spelling knowledge.
Year 6
In the final year of primary school, Year 6 students consolidate their language skills in preparation for secondary school.
Teach Starter's year 6 reading and writing resources will help your students engage with various texts — including those that present different perspectives and challenge ideas.
Build advanced comprehension strategies — such as inference, synthesis and evaluation — and refine their writing skills by exploring different genres, styles and voices. Grammar, vocabulary and spelling are all covered with various options available.
